Responsibilities
Manage audit programs, including the vault, cage activity, table games activity, slot activity, food and beverage transactions, jackpot fills, cash dispensing kiosks, and coupons
Ensure the integrity and reliability of financial information, appropriate transaction authorization, safeguarding of assets, and regulatory compliance
Maintain awareness of internal controls required by state lottery regulations and common casino standards
Assist Accounting Director in developing and updating policies and procedures for the revenue accounting department
Provide recommendations to management on issues pertaining to gaming audit, accounting, and regulations
Oversee team members by providing leadership, mentoring, and administering annual performance reviews
